Recent Trends in Xiaomi’s Global Expansion and Media Coverage
Over the past year, Xiaomi has actively expanded its global footprint, entering new markets and increasing product offerings internationally. Media coverage has traditionally been concentrated within China, but recent data from GDELT indicates a sharp rise in mentions worldwide, especially in regions like Europe and Southeast Asia. Historically, Xiaomi’s growth has been driven by affordable smartphones and innovative technology, with recent efforts emphasizing smart home devices and AI integration. The recent surge in coverage aligns with these strategic shifts and international marketing campaigns.
